6218 Palma Del Mar Blvd S is located in St. Petersburg, near the intersection of Gulf Boulevard and 75th Avenue. This high-rise building stands at 6 stories tall and holds 36 condominium units. Built in 1979, it gives residents views of the golf course, pool, garden, and nearby trees. A short drive leads to St. Pete Beach and Fort DeSoto Park.
Units in the building range from 780 to 1,050 square feet. There are both 1 and 2 bedroom options available. Prices for these units typically range from $450,000 to $498,000. In the last year, the average sold price was $337,500, and the average price per square foot came to $380. Most units spent around 85 days on the market before selling.
Amenities provided in the building add to the lifestyle of residents. The property features a resort-style heated pool, fitness center, and recreation facilities. Sidewalks and street lights around the building create a safe environment. Other amenities include a clubhouse, tennis courts, and a community laundry room.
Assigned covered parking is available, along with a boat slip for those who enjoy water activities. Many units have desirable features like floor-to-ceiling windows, open-concept living spaces, and screened-in balconies. The building also includes key-required lobby access and handicap modifications.
Nearby dining options like Tokyo Bay Japanese Restaurant and Board Walk offer choices for meals out. Residents can enjoy various outdoor activities and connect to the vibrant atmosphere of downtown St. Petersburg. The location balances a relaxed community feel with easy access to urban conveniences and scenic views of Boca Ciega Bay.

Isla Del Sol is a waterfront community in Pinellas County, Florida. The area has beaches, parks, and marinas along calm bays. This district offers small grocery stores, cafes, and local shops. It has a community center and waterfront walking paths. Ferry service and nearby bridges link the island to the mainland. Bus routes run close by, and major roads connect to nearby cities. Schools and basic health services sit a short drive away. The area stays quiet and still gives easy access to shopping and coastal recreation.

This neighborhood indicates a good mix of people which makes it a good place for families. About 5.24% are children aged 0–14, 8.88% are young adults between 15–29, 12.01% are adults aged 30–44, 17.14% are in the 45–59 range and 56.73% are seniors aged 60 and above.
Commuting options are also varying where 76.99% of residents relying on driving, while others prefer public transit around 0.04%, walking around 1.68%, biking around 0.43%, allowing residents to choose travel modes that best fit their daily routines.
Most homes in the area are with 84.61% of units owner occupied and 15.39% are rented.
The neighborhood offers different household types. About 10.01% are single family homes and 1.26% are multi family units. Around 29.38% are single-person households, while 70.62% are multi person households. This mix works well for families, roommates, and individuals.
Education levels in the neighborhood vary widely where 27.86% of residents have bachelor’s degrees. Around 17.72% have high school or college education. Another 11.56% hold diplomas while 23.81% have completed postgraduate studies. The remaining are 19.04% with other types of qualifications.
